About aluminum tris(1-methoxypropan-2-olate)

aluminum tris(1-methoxypropan-2-olate) (PubChem CID 173049234) has the molecular formula C12H27AlO6 and a molecular weight of 294.32 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is aluminum tris(1-methoxypropan-2-olate).
